INSTALLING THE GAME FOR THE FIRST TIME
Create a directory to set up the Freshwater Fishing Simulator door.
Un archive the Freshwater Fishing Simulator files into the directory you
have created to run the door from.
All that needs to be done to setup the door, is to run FFSCFG.EXE,
then run FISHMANT.EXE. These two programs will create all needed files.
FFSCFG.EXE
Comm Setup : the locked baud rate can be set here for up to 8 nodes.
This way if your running multi-node at different locked
rates you won't need separate batch files.
The IRQ and Base Addr should only be set if you use
Non Standard configuration.
Door Setup : BBS Name 1,2 - Displayed at logon if door is registered
and when exiting from door.
Time Aloud in Door - Amount of time user is aloud in door.
Days Until Inactive Users are Deleted - Number of days
until inactive users are deleted from
player database.
Registration String - String specified to register door by,
can be sysop name, bbs name or handle.
In version 1.82 and earlier the was referred
to by Registered Sysop Name.
Registration Code - Code based on registration string.
Registered/Adopted - select what string to display at logon.
Tournament Setup : Select the Fish, then Start Date and Length of
Tournament.
Start Date can be be any date, so you can have a
tournament set in advance, or if you want weekly
tournaments (sun-sat) and your setting up on a
tuesday. You can have it start the previous sunday.
Repeat is used to keep tournaments going after they
have been completed. When FISHMANT.EXE is run after
12:00 midnight the last tournament day. The Result
are reported and and the tournament is either:
Repeat Yes - reset with a random fish type and and
starts the day after the last one ended.
Repeat No - cleared to no tournament.
The option to have the tournaments to stop after
completion is used if you want to use one slot for
just a weekend tournament. Set it for fri-sun then
it won't repeat monday and you set it up again for
fri-sun. This way you don't have to interrupt a
tournament in progress. Which if players where into
might not go well.
=== Command Line ============================================================
Local Format : FISHING /L or LOCAL
BBS Format : FISHING BBStype BBSpath Node# [/Bxxxxxxx] [/F]
BBSType = 1 DORINFOx.DEF x = Node# (0,1,2)
2 DOOR.SYS
3 CALLINFO.BBS
4 SFDOORS.DAT
5 PCBOARD.SYS
6 INFO.BBS
BBSpath = Path to drop file. Must be included.
Nodex = only used when BBSType = 1. (DORINFOx.DEF)
/Bxxxxxxx = For locked baud rates. (i.e. Modem locked at 19200 = /B19200)
Now can be set from FFSCFG.EXE. Left here for compatibility
/F = enable FOSSIL routines. FOSSIL support is kept for non standard
serial devices or any other hardware/software that needs a FOSSIL
driver to operate.
The FOSSIL driver is not auto detected any more. /F must be on the
command line, to enable the routines.
